Merge tag 'usb-5.1-rc1' of git://git.kernel.org/pub/scm/linux/kernel/git/gregkh/usb
Pull USB/PHY updates from Greg KH: "Here is the big USB/PHY driver pull request for 5.1-rc1. The usual set of gadget driver updates, phy driver updates, xhci updates, and typec additions. Also included in here are a lot of small cleanups and fixes and driver updates where needed. All of these have been in linux-next for a while with no reported issues" * tag 'usb-5.1-rc1' of git://git.kernel.org/pub/scm/linux/kernel/git/gregkh/usb: (167 commits) wusb: Remove unnecessary static function ckhdid_printf usb: core: make default autosuspend delay configurable usb: core: Fix typo in description of "authorized_default" usb: chipidea: Refactor USB PHY selection and keep a single PHY usb: chipidea: Grab the (legacy) USB PHY by phandle first usb: chipidea: imx: set power polarity dt-bindings: usb: ci-hdrc-usb2: add property power-active-high usb: chipidea: imx: remove unused header files usb: chipidea: tegra: Fix missed ci_hdrc_remove_device() usb: core: add option of only authorizing internal devices usb: typec: tps6598x: handle block writes separately with plain-I2C adapters usb: xhci: Fix for Enabling USB ROLE SWITCH QUIRK on INTEL_SUNRISEPOINT_LP_XHCI usb: xhci: fix build warning - missing prototype usb: xhci: dbc: Fixing typo error. usb: xhci: remove unused member 'parent' in xhci_regset struct xhci: tegra: Prevent error pointer dereference USB: serial: option: add Telit ME910 ECM composition usb: core: Replace hardcoded check with inline function from usb.h usb: core: skip interfaces disabled in devicetree usb: typec: mux: remove redundant check on variable match ...
